055 [Situation] On the left bank of the River Nith about 14 chains SW [South West] of Kingholm Quay
A Small but safe harbour on the West side
of the River Nith affords a Mooring -place for two Vessels of about 50 or 60 Tons Burthen .- The Imports are Timber, Coal &c.

055 1 1/4 Mile S. [South] of Dumfries
A Small village on the Eastern bank of River Nith. - In it are two public -houses, one Grocer's shop, And a woollen Mill, the latter giving employment on an average to about 200 persopns The village is Commonly Called The New Quay
